Something I hadn't thought about until class was how similar Fumes is to Bran in Game of Thrones. Both gain immense knowledge after enduring an accident which makes them key players in understanding what has happened or how to communicate with others. Yet, they both lose their identity to their new knowledge. They also can't really think or feel for themselves. At first, I thought this was a tragic thing. However, someone (I think Erik) brought up how this lifestyle doesn't seem to bother Fumes in the same way that Bran doesn't seem bothered by the sacrifices he gave to become the Three -Eye-Raven.
